How much do driver average j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for driver average in Utah is $34.41,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.88 and $37.64 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How much does an average driver make?

The average driver salary varies depending on the industry and experience, but generally ranges from $30,000 to $50,000 annually. Commercial drivers, such as truck or delivery drivers, often earn more with additional certifications and experience. Factors like location, hours worked, and type of vehicle also influence earnings.

Is a driver a good career?

A driver can be a stable career option with opportunities in transportation, delivery, and logistics industries. It often requires a valid license, good driving record, and sometimes specialized certifications, with work schedules varying from daily shifts to long-haul routes. Job stability and income depend on the industry, location, and experience level.

What are some common challenges drivers may face on the job, and how can they prepare for them?

Drivers often encounter challenges such as navigating heavy traffic, adhering to tight schedules, and dealing with unexpected vehicle breakdowns or weather conditions. To prepare, it's important to develop strong time management skills, stay updated on local traffic patterns, and perform regular vehicle maintenance checks. Good communication with dispatchers and other team members also helps address issues quickly and maintain efficiency on the road.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a driver average?

To thrive as a Driver, you need a valid driver's license, a clean driving record, and a good understanding of road safety regulations.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, vehicle maintenance basics, and sometimes special certifications (like CDL for commercial drivers) are commonly required. Reliability, attention to detail, and strong customer service skills help drivers stand out in the role. These competencies ensure safe, timely, and efficient transportation while maintaining high standards of service and compliance.

Route Details:

Dedicated Dollar Tree fleet is hiring CDL-A Drivers. Drivers will deliver dry freight and unload full truck loads using a roto cart and a lift gate, averaging 3 loads per week. Loads begin in Phoenix, AZ, delivering to AZ, UT, and some Southern CA. On this route drivers get home weekly with a 34-hour rest period. Drivers will park their vehicle at home or a secure location.
